aboutsummaryrefslogtreecommitdiff
path: root/tests/io_sync_bridge.rs
diff options
context:
space:
mode:
authorJeff Vander Stoep <jeffv@google.com>2024-02-05 14:19:11 +0000
committerA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>2024-02-05 14:19:11 +0000
commit646d9067cfe1430335326bd1a5ffe46d370addd2 (patch)
tree3044f4002ed695e6540a4969306b4304349073ce /tests/io_sync_bridge.rs
parent3b1161ba9718578d32f382256dee18a97d01d180 (diff)
parenta7879fe08376d6c078eed44ffd47a14fb340af59 (diff)
downloadtokio-util-646d9067cfe1430335326bd1a5ffe46d370addd2.tar.gz
Upgrade tokio-util to 0.7.10 am: a7879fe083emu-34-2-dev
Original change: https://android-review.googlesource.com/c/platform/external/rust/crates/tokio-util/+/2950425 Change-Id: If80db06d7ac2be560713c61ae717d03ae2fcb068 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
Diffstat (limited to 'tests/io_sync_bridge.rs')
-rw-r--r--tests/io_sync_bridge.rs12
1 files changed, 12 insertions, 0 deletions
diff --git a/tests/io_sync_bridge.rs b/tests/io_sync_bridge.rs
index 76bbd0b..50d0e89 100644
--- a/tests/io_sync_bridge.rs
+++ b/tests/io_sync_bridge.rs
@@ -44,6 +44,18 @@ async fn test_async_write_to_sync() -> Result<(), Box<dyn Error>> {
}
#[tokio::test]
+async fn test_into_inner() -> Result<(), Box<dyn Error>> {
+ let mut buf = Vec::new();
+ SyncIoBridge::new(tokio::io::empty())
+ .into_inner()
+ .read_to_end(&mut buf)
+ .await
+ .unwrap();
+ assert_eq!(buf.len(), 0);
+ Ok(())
+}
+
+#[tokio::test]
async fn test_shutdown() -> Result<(), Box<dyn Error>> {
let (s1, mut s2) = tokio::io::duplex(1024);
let (_rh, wh) = tokio::io::split(s1);